Hi all

This series patch is for rockchip Type-C phy and DisplayPort controller
driver.

The USB Type-C PHY is designed to support the USB3 and DP applications.
The PHY basically has two main components: USB3 and DisplyPort. USB3
operates in SuperSpeed mode and the DP can operate at RBR, HBR and HBR2
data rates. The Type-C cable orientation detection and Power Delivery
(PD) is accomplished using a PD PHY or a exernal PD chip.

The DP controller is compliant with DisplayPort Specification,
Version 1.3, This IP is compatible with the rockchip type-c PHY IP.
There is a uCPU in DP controller, it need a firmware to work, please
put the firmware file to /lib/firmware/cdn/dptx.bin. The uCPU in charge
of aux communication and link training, the host use mailbox to
communicate with the ucpu.

The PHY driver has register a notification with extcon API, to get the
alt mode from PD, the PD driver need call the devm_extcon_dev_allocate
to create a extcon device and use extcon_set_state to notify PHY and
DP controller.

About the DP audio, cdn-dp registered 2 DAIs: 0 is I2S, 1 is SPDIF.
We can reference them in simple-card.

> On a slightly unrelated note, I'm not sure if we discussed this already
> or if it was in another thread, but why is this even a bridge driver? A
> bridge is typically some IC outside of the SoC, whereas this clearly is
> IP designed into the SoC. So it's really more of an encoder rather than
> a bridge.
I guess you mean this thread <https://patchwork.kernel.org/patch/5816991/>
I think the bridge is beneficial to share the dw-mipi driver for 
different soc
with same version dw-mipi IP.

+#include 
+#include 
+#include 
+#include 
+#include 
+#include

+Device-Tree bindings for Synopsys DesignWare MIPI DSI host controller
+
+The controller is a digital core that implements all protocol functions
+defined in the MIPI DSI specification, providing an interface between
+the system and the MIPI DPHY, and allowing communication with a MIPI DSI
+compliant display.
+
+Required properties:
+ - #address-cells: Should be <1>.
+ - #size-cells: Should be <0>.
+ - compatible: The first compatible string should be "fsl,imx6q-mipi-dsi"
+   for i.MX6q/sdl SoCs.  For other SoCs, please refer to their specific
+   device tree binding documentations.  A common compatible string
+   "snps,dw-mipi-dsi" should be appended for all SoCs.
+ - reg: Represent the physical address range of the controller.
+ - interrupts: Represent the controller's interrupt to the CPU(s).
+ - clocks, clock-names: Phandles to the controller's pll reference
+   clock(ref), configuration clock(cfg) and APB clock(pclk), as
+   described in [1].
+ - port@[X]: SoC specific port nodes with endpoint definitions as defined
+   in Documentation/devicetree/bindings/media/video-interfaces.txt,
+   please refer to the SoC specific binding document:
+* 
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/rockchip/dw_mipi_dsi-rockchip.txt
+
+
+For more required properties, please refer to relevant device tree binding
+documentations which describe the controller embedded in specific SoCs.
+
+Required sub-nodes:
+ - A node to represent a DSI peripheral as described in [2].
+
+For more required sub-nodes, please refer to relevant device tree binding
+documentations which describe the controller embedded in specific SoCs.
+
+[1]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/clock-bindings.txt
+[2]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/mipi-dsi-bus.txt
+
